def test_watch_toggle_issue(self): issue = test_data.create_dummy_issue() user = issue.createdByUser self.assertTrue(not watch_services.is_watching_issue(user, issue.id)) watch_services.watch_issue(user, issue.id, IssueWatch.WATCHED) self.assertTrue(watch_services.is_watching_issue(user, issue.id)) watch_services.unwatch_issue(user, issue.id) self.assertTrue(not watch_services.is_watching_issue(user, issue.id))
def unwatchIssue(request, issue_id): watch_services.unwatch_issue(request.user, int(issue_id)) return HttpResponse('NOT_WATCHING')